What is a CNA?
A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) plays a vital role in the healthcare system, providing essential care to patients under the supervision of nursing staff. Their responsibilities typically include:
- Assisting patients with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and eating.
- Monitoring patients’ vital signs and reporting changes to nurses.
- Helping with mobility and physical therapy exercises.
- Maintaining a clean and safe environment for patients.

Exploring Online CNA Schools
Online CNA programs provide students with the opportunity to complete coursework from home, making it convenient and flexible. Here’s what to consider when searching for the right online CNA school:
Accreditation
Ensure that the online CNA school is accredited by the appropriate governing bodies. Accreditation ensures the program meets specific educational standards and qualifies you for certification upon completion.
Curriculum and Format
Look for a program that offers a comprehensive curriculum, including both theoretical knowledge and hands-on clinical training. Most online programs will require in-person clinical experience at a healthcare facility.
Cost and Financial Aid
Compare tuition costs across different programs. Keep an eye out for financial aid opportunities, scholarships, and payment plans that can help make education more affordable.

Steps to Getting Certified as a CNA
Follow these essential steps to secure your CNA certification:
1. Choose the Right Online CNA Program
Research different online CNA schools based on the criteria mentioned above and select one that fits your needs.
2. Complete the Required Training
Complete the coursework and clinical hours as mandated by your chosen program. This typically includes:
- Fundamentals of nursing.
- Patient care procedures.
- Medical terminology and ethics.
3. Pass the State Certification Exam
After completing your training, you will need to take the CNA certification exam in your state. The exam usually consists of two parts: a written portion and a skills examination.
4. Register with Your State’s Nursing Board
Once you pass the exam, you must register with your state’s nursing board to practice legally as a CNA.
